Join us for a special time of gratitude and celebration at our Thanksgiving Service every Sunday at 12:00 pm at Cherubim and Seraphim Church New York. As we gather together in thanksgiving and praise, we reflect on God’s abundant blessings and rejoice in His faithfulness throughout the week. Our Thanksgiving Service is a time-honored tradition where we come before the Lord with hearts full of thankfulness and voices lifted in praise. It’s an opportunity for us to pause, acknowledge God’s goodness, and express our gratitude for His provision, protection, and presence in our lives. During our Thanksgiving Service, we offer prayers of thanksgiving, sing hymns of praise, and share testimonies of God’s faithfulness and provision. It’s a time to remember and celebrate the countless blessings we’ve received, both big and small, and to give thanks to the One who deserves all the glory and honor. At Cherubim and Seraphim Church New York, we believe that gratitude is a powerful spiritual discipline that cultivates a heart of humility and contentment. That’s why our Thanksgiving Service isn’t just a once-a-year event but a weekly reminder to pause and give thanks to God for His goodness and grace.
